Subject: Cron drift — new owner

Team,

Effective Monday, ownership of the cron drift investigation (the Halvard schedulers firing 3–7 minutes late) moves off my plate. Open findings live in the Driftwatch doc. Don't restart the scheduler fleet without checking the doc first. All questions now go to the person named below.

named custodian: Oliath Ralax

## Capacity notes: LedgeDiff large-file mode

LedgeDiff switches to chunked streaming above the size threshold. Memory per worker scales with chunk size times window depth, not file size. Don't raise chunk size to "fix" slow diffs — it just moves the cost to RAM and causes OOM kills on the shared pool. Each worker holds at most two windows. Budget roughly 1.5x the window product per concurrent diff. Current production constants are listed below; change them only via a capacity review.

tuning constants:
QUOTAS = {
    "druwyn": 5,
    "holix": 5,
    "zorath": 5,
    "holwyn": 10,
}

# Thornvale Retention Sweeper — Environments

The sweeper runs in staging and production only; there is no dev instance, since deletions are irreversible. Staging points at a synthetic dataset refreshed weekly, so support can safely test retention rules there before promoting them. Production sweeps nightly and honors legal holds automatically. Before escalating any "data missing" tickets, verify which environment the customer record lived in. The production configuration is as follows.

settings of bafof-fajog:
[aldix]
port = 9300
region = north-3
host = aldix.kelvilabs.example
team = istath
timeout_ms = 1500
retries = 8

## Environments: ORM Refactor

The Brindlewood catalog service is midway through replacing the legacy Hartle ORM with hand-written query builders. Staging runs the new layer exclusively; production still dual-writes so we can diff results nightly. Releases must keep both code paths deployable until the diff job reports two clean weeks. Rollback is a flag flip, not a redeploy. The environment currently runs with the following configuration values.

config for tagep-yajef:
ulawyn:
  log_level: error
  metrics_host: metrics.ulawyn.lumiclabs.internal
  pin: 0564
  pool_size: 32